The Task That Has Fallen To Us As Americans Is To Move The Conscience Of The World, To Keep Alive The Hope And Dream Of Freedom. For If We Fail Or Falter, There'll Be No Place For The World's Oppressed To Flee To. This Is Not A Role We Sought. We Preach No Manifest Destiny. But Like The Americans Who Brought A New Nation Into The World 200 Years Ago, History Has Asked Much Of Us In Our Time. Much We've Already Given; Much More We Must Be Prepared To Give.
-Ronald Reagan
